The overview below groups typical Barn Roof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in West Des Moines, IA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or barn roof repairs, such as replacing a few shingles or fixing leaks, generally range from $250-$600. Most routine repairs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of the damage and materials needed.
Partial Roof Replacement - When only part of the barn roof requires replacement, local contractors usually charge between $1,500-$4,000. Larger, more complex partial projects can approach $5,000 or more, though these are less common.
Full Roof Replacement - Complete barn roof replacements often cost between $4,000-$10,000, depending on the size and materials used. Many full replacements fall into the middle of this range, with higher costs associated with larger or premium-material roofs.
Complex or Custom Projects - Larger, custom, or intricate barn roof projects can exceed $10,000, especially for historical restorations or specialty materials. These projects are less frequent but represent the upper end of typical costs for local service providers.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of barn roof materials are available for installation? Local contractors can install a variety of barn roof materials, including metal, asphalt shingles, and wood shakes, to suit different styles and functional needs.
How do I know if my barn roof needs replacement or repairs? Service providers can assess the condition of a barn roof to determine whether repairs are sufficient or if a full replacement is necessary based on wear, damage, and age.
What are common signs of barn roof damage? Signs include missing or broken shingles, rust or corrosion on metal roofs, water leaks inside the barn, and visible sagging or warping of roof panels.
Can local contractors handle different barn roof styles? Yes, experienced service providers can work with various roof styles such as gable, gambrel, or hip roofs, ensuring proper installation and support.
